Dying in Place: Factors Associated with Hospice Use in Assisted Living and Residential Care Communities in Oregon

ORCID Icon, ORCID Icon & ORCID Icon
 

Abstract

Hospice use among assisted living residents may support aging in place. A cross-sectional survey was used to characterize variation in the health and personal care needs of Oregon assisted living and residential care (AL/RC) residents who did and did not receive hospice services. All AL communities licensed in Oregon as of fall 2019 were asked to answer questions about three randomly selected residents. A final sample of 998 residents was included in the analysis. Multiple variable logistic regression was used to examine associations between resident- and community-level characteristics and hospice use. While hospice services provide supplemental support for AL residents’ end-of-life process, our findings show that residents often receive continued assistance from AL staff as their condition deteriorates.
